Abstract

This research problem stems from students' low interest, motivation, and understanding of forward rolling, and the need for more engaging, effective, and easily understood learning innovations. Conventional learning often leads to students' inactivity and lack of enthusiasm in participating in the learning process. This study aimed to determine the implementation of audio-visual media in forward rolling floor gymnastics lessons at SMP Negeri 15 Padang. The study used a descriptive method, with a population of 643 students at SMP Negeri 15 Padang. A sample of 34 students was selected using purposive random sampling. The instrument used was a closed-ended questionnaire with a Guttman scale consisting of 40 questions and covering ten indicators of audio-visual media implementation. Data were analyzed using frequency distribution techniques and presented in percentages. The results showed that the implementation of audio-visual media in forward rolling floor gymnastics lessons was categorized as very good. The use of audio-visual media increased students' attention, motivation, and understanding of the material being taught. Furthermore, these media help students understand the stages of movement more clearly, increase engagement during learning, strengthen memory, and support the creation of a more effective, engaging, enjoyable, and meaningful learning process for students in various learning situations at school in an optimal and sustainable manner.
